Another year end type feature. This one from Popular Mechanics is not a look back but a look forward to important technology concepts for next year. Many of them will (or at least could) have a direct impact on dentistry and the technology we use every day. # 6 is osseointegration, yes the same ossesointegration we have used in dentistry for over 25 years. The future prediction is that it will soon be used for full-scale limb prosthetics.
